Product Description
QSFP-DD 200G Ethernet Transceiver Module For ER4 40km SMF With FEC,12W Power Consumption
This product is a 200Gb/s transceiver module designed for 40km optical communication applications. The design is compliant to IEEE802.3bs 200GBASE-ER4 standard. The module converts 8 input channels(ch) of 25Gb/s electrical data to 4 channels of LWDM optical signals, and multiplexes them into a single channel for 200Gb/s (PAM4) optical transmission. Reversely, on the receiver side, the module optically de-multiplexes a 200Gb/s(PAM4) input into 4 LWDM channels of signals, and converts them to 8 channels output electrical data.
Key Features
- QSFP-DD MSA compliant
- 4 CWDM lanes MUX/DEMUX design
- Up to 40km transmission on single mode fiber (SMF) with FEC
- Operating case temperature: 0 to 70℃
- Maximum power consumption 12W
- Duplex LC connector
- RoHS compliant
